Step-by-step explanation:

Given :

Equation is    2/3 y − 9 < y + 1

Now translating the above given equation in the sentence we can write,                

"Two thirds of y minus nine is less than y plus one."

Thus the answer is

Two thirds of y minus nine is less than y plus one.
